RDS (Relational Database Service) is a cloud-based service provided by major cloud platforms like Amazon Web Services (AWS) that simplifies the management, operation, and scaling of relational databases. Whether you’re running a small web application or a large-scale enterprise system, RDS offers a highly efficient way to handle your database needs without the complexity of traditional database management.

What is RDS?

RDS is a fully managed relational database service that provides users with scalable, secure, and high-performance databases in the cloud. It eliminates the need for users to handle database administration tasks like patching, backups, scaling, and high availability, allowing businesses to focus on their core operations while RDS takes care of the underlying infrastructure.

With RDS, you can easily set up, operate, and scale databases such as MySQL, PostgreSQL, MariaDB, Oracle, and Microsoft SQL Server. It offers a simple and cost-effective solution for businesses of all sizes, from startups to large enterprises.

Key Features of RDS

Managed Service:
RDS removes the complexities of manual database management. It automatically handles routine tasks such as database patching, backups, and recovery, allowing developers and database administrators to focus on application development instead.

Scalability:
RDS is designed to scale easily as your business grows. You can resize your database instance to accommodate higher traffic, storage, and processing requirements without downtime. It also supports both vertical and horizontal scaling, giving you flexibility based on your specific needs.

High Availability:
With RDS, you can deploy your database in multiple availability zones to ensure high availability and fault tolerance. Automated backups and replication across different regions ensure that your data is protected and available at all times, even in case of system failures.

Security:
RDS provides robust security features to protect your data, including encryption at rest and in transit. You can also set up network isolation, define access control policies, and use multi-factor authentication for an added layer of protection.

Automated Backups and Snapshots:
RDS automatically takes daily backups of your database, enabling point-in-time recovery in case of data loss or corruption. You can also create manual snapshots for specific database states that you can restore whenever necessary.

Cost-Effective:
With RDS, you only pay for what you use, which means you can save costs by paying for the database storage and compute resources as needed. RDS offers different pricing models (on-demand or reserved instances), giving businesses the flexibility to choose the most cost-effective solution.

Performance Monitoring:
RDS comes with built-in monitoring and metrics that give you insights into your database’s health, performance, and resource utilization. You can use AWS CloudWatch to monitor key metrics such as CPU utilization, memory usage, and storage I/O, helping you make informed decisions about your database infrastructure.

Benefits of Using RDS

Reduced Administrative Overhead:
Since RDS handles maintenance tasks like backups, patch management, and scaling, it frees up time for your team to focus on application development rather than database administration.

Improved Performance:
RDS allows you to easily scale up your database performance by choosing the appropriate instance type or adding read replicas to distribute read traffic, ensuring optimal performance as your application grows.

Seamless Integration:
RDS integrates seamlessly with other cloud services, such as compute resources (EC2), storage solutions (S3), and data warehousing (Redshift). This enables businesses to create robust and scalable cloud-based architectures that meet their needs.

Flexibility in Database Engines:
With support for popular database engines like MySQL, PostgreSQL, SQL Server, and Oracle, RDS gives you the flexibility to choose the database that best suits your application, without worrying about underlying hardware or infrastructure management.

Business Continuity and Disaster Recovery:
RDS ensures business continuity with automated backups, cross-region replication, and failover capabilities. In case of a failure, you can quickly restore your database to its last known good state, minimizing downtime and ensuring data availability.
